**Q: Why do Quillhook serverless handlers cold-start slowly after a vault reseal?**

A: On reseal, each handler must refetch its decryption material before serving traffic, adding several seconds to the first invocation. Reviewers should confirm the warmup hook is registered. To unseal the staging vault and restore normal cold-start times, use the recovery passphrase below.

unlock words, hahip-yagef: zorok-novmir-zorix-silax

RUNBOOK 4.2 — Paper Ledger Archiving

Closed ledgers from the Dunmarch office are boxed quarterly and sent to the Fennick Street archive. Dispatch confirms box counts against the manifest, seals each carton, and books the afternoon courier run. Ledgers must never sit overnight at the desk. The handover to the courier follows the confidential instruction below.

courier memo of yahif-faweg: the quenael tamius courier leaves the prawyn jorix kaswyn istox silmir brieth zormir fenvan ledger at gate 3145 under passcode 231062

Subject: GraphLoom 1.9 release notes for support

Team — GraphLoom 1.9 is rolling out to all tenants over the next 48 hours. Key changes you may field tickets about: the dependency graph visualizer now collapses transitive edges by default (toggle under View > Edge Depth), and cyclic dependencies render in amber rather than red. Cached layouts from 1.8 are invalidated on first load, so expect slow initial renders. When logging tickets, please attach the build token shown below.

trace token, fafof-tajef: htk9_849b0fd88

- [ ] Step 7: Archive cold storage buckets (Glacierline tier). Confirm both ceremony witnesses are present, verify bucket manifests match the Oxbow ledger, then seal the archive key shares. Plugin authors may observe but not handle shares. Once sealed, the archive index itself is encrypted and can only be reopened with the passphrase below.

vault phrase of badup-hahig = tamael-aldael-kelmir-istael-fenok-istwyn-tamius-jorath-oliion

## Service accounts & the DNS flakiness

Heads up: the resolver inside the Mistvale cluster occasionally drops lookups for internal hostnames, so service-account calls time out randomly. Workaround for now: retry with backoff and log the failure to the netwatch service. To authenticate those diagnostic calls, use the shared netwatch key below.

app token of tagef-tafog = qvz3-7n0